
Iron Maiden
The prominent band from the 'New Wave of British Heavy Metal' (NWOBHM), Iron Maiden, originated from the creativity of bassist-songwriter Steve Harris, who is the only member with a presence on all records alongside guitarist Dave Murray. They are recognized for their music featuring twin-lead harmony guitars (a nod to Judas Priest), galloping bass lines, and operatic vocals, with lyrics often exploring themes that are spooky, historical, or inspired by literature/movies. Their most renowned tracks are either high-energy rockers that typically open albums and become singles (like "Aces High," "The Wicker Man") or intricate epics that often conclude their albums (such as "Hallowed Be Thy Name," "Fear of the Dark"). Particularly notable is their mascot, 'Eddie the Head,' an albino zombie that decorates their artwork, created by Derek Riggs, Maiden's long-term artist and album cover designer. Eddie is also featured on stage as part of the set or as a character in a large costume.
Established in London in 1975, the band faced challenges in the club circuit with a frequently changing lineup until their 1979 demo, The Soundhouse Tapes, secured them a recording contract with EMI. Their initial two albums achieved moderate success, and with the arrival of singer Bruce Dickinson for their third album, The Number of the Beast (1982), Iron Maiden became a leading band in the metal genre. The band has sold over 85 million records globally (including 16 studio albums, 7 compilations, and numerous live albums and videos) and has toured 59 countries, performing over 5000 concerts.
**Members**
**Current**
- Steve Harris – bass (1975-present), keyboards (1997-present)
- Dave Murray – guitars (1976-1977, 1978-present)
- Adrian Smith – guitars (1980-1990, 1999-present)
- Bruce Dickinson – vocals (1981-1993, 1999-present)
- Nicko McBrain – drums (1982-present)
- Janick Gers – guitars (1990-present)
**Past**
- Doug Sampson – drums (1977-1979)
- Paul Di'Anno – vocals (1978-1981)
- Dennis Stratton – guitars (1979-1980)
- Clive Burr – drums (1979-1982)
- Blaze Bayley – vocals (1994-1999)
**Touring**
- Michael Kenney – keyboards (1988-2022)
